Diesel Engine Types

Diesel engines are widely used in transportation, agriculture, construction, power generation, and marine applications because they are efficient, durable, and capable of producing high torque. There are several types of diesel engines, and each type is designed for specific operating conditions and performance requirements. Understanding these engine types helps explain why diesel technology remains important across many industries.One common way to classify diesel engines is by their cycle of operation. The most widely used type is the four-stroke diesel engine. It completes its operating cycle in four piston strokes: intake, compression, power, and exhaust. During the intake stroke, only air enters the cylinder. The air is then compressed to a very high pressure, which raises its temperature. Near the end of the compression stroke, fuel is injected into the hot air, where it ignites automatically. The resulting combustion pushes the piston downward and creates power. Four-stroke diesel engines are known for good fuel economy, lower emissions compared with older systems, and reliable long-term performance.Another important type is the two-stroke diesel engine. This engine completes a full cycle in just two piston strokes, which allows it to produce power more frequently than a four-stroke engine. Two-stroke diesel engines are often used in large marine vessels and heavy industrial equipment because they can deliver very high power output. However, they are generally larger, heavier, and more complex than four-stroke engines. They also require careful design to manage lubrication, cooling, and exhaust flow.Diesel engines can also be classified by their cooling system. Air-cooled diesel engines use airflow to remove heat from the engine block and cylinders. These engines are simpler and lighter, which makes them useful in smaller machines and equipment operating in areas where water cooling may be inconvenient. Water-cooled diesel engines use a liquid coolant that circulates through the engine to absorb and carry away heat. This system is more common in vehicles and larger machinery because it maintains stable operating temperatures and improves engine durability.Another distinction is between naturally aspirated and turbocharged diesel engines. Naturally aspirated diesel engines draw air into the cylinders without any forced induction. They are simpler and often less expensive, but they usually produce less power. Turbocharged diesel engines use exhaust gas energy to drive a turbine, which compresses incoming air and increases the amount of oxygen available for combustion. This improves power output, fuel efficiency, and altitude performance. Many modern diesel engines also use intercoolers to cool the compressed air before it enters the cylinder, further increasing performance.Diesel engines may also differ by injection system. Mechanical injection systems use pumps and injectors controlled by engine components, while electronic common rail systems use high-pressure fuel delivery controlled by sensors and an electronic unit. Common rail diesel engines provide more precise fuel metering, smoother operation, lower noise, and reduced emissions. They are widely used in modern passenger vehicles and commercial equipment.In summary, diesel engines come in several types, including four-stroke, two-stroke, air-cooled, water-cooled, naturally aspirated, and turbocharged designs. Each type has specific advantages depending on its intended use. Their strength, efficiency, and adaptability continue to make diesel engines valuable in many fields.
